That's correct August, and what the BBC is doing is that you will need an account to watch iplayer which will be linked to your TV licence so that you have to have a TV licence to watch iplayer.

http://www.tvlicensing.co.uk/check-if-you-need-one


Quote:
Live TV means any programme you watch or record as it’s being shown on TV or live on any online TV service. It’s not just live events like sport, news and music. It covers all programmes on any channel, including soaps, series, documentaries and even movies.
If you’re watching live TV, you need to be covered by a TV Licence:
  • if you’re watching on TV or on an online TV service
  • for all channels, not just the BBC
  • if you record a programme and watch it later
  • if you watch a programme on a delay
  • to watch or record repeats
  • to watch or record programmes on +1, +2 and +24 channels
  • to watch live programmes on Red Button services
  • even if you already pay for cable, satellite or other TV services


An online TV service is any streaming or smart TV service, website or app that lets you watch live TV over the internet. This includes services like All 4, Sky Go, Virgin Media, Now TV, BT TV, Apple TV, YouTube, Amazon Instant Video and ITV Hub

I could be remembering wrong

Some years ago the Swedish government introduced a "computer license" because the government said that those who own a computer could also see SVT on this equipment.

Some years later the High court overruled this law-saying that a computer wasn't build to watch tv like a TV itself.

Swedish license office had to repay about 70 million back to those who owned a computer(can remember exact wording)
